Wyalusing State Park

Wyalusing State Park has some of the most spectacular lookouts in the area. Here you can marvel at the spectacular views of where the great Wisconsin and the mighty Mississippi River join. Camp 500 feet above the confluence of these beautiful rivers in one of Wisconsin's old parks.
 WISCONSIN TRAILS magazine readers voted this "Wisconsin's best scenic view". You will find picnic areas, shelters, hiking trails, campgrounds and mountain bike trails. 
This park is open year round with cross country ski trails for the hearty, canoe trails through the backwaters of the Mississippi for the adventurous, and historic Indian mounds for the history buffs. Come and enjoy the great outdoors and watch the birds and abundant wildlife of the park, and explore the caves, canyons and rock formations. Also located in the park, is marker recognizing the spot where Marquette and Joliet entered the Mississippi River on June 17, 1673.
